Chassis offers cooling for up to 75W per slot

Curtiss-Wright Controls Electronic Systems has introduced a 12-slot 3U OpenVPX forced air conduction-cooled chassis that is suitable for developing military embedded systems. The RME9CC chassis is the latest member of Electronic Systems' Hybricon family of advanced military commercial off-the-shelf electronic packaging solutions and provides cooling for up to 75W per slot. It is designed for 3U 1inch pitch payload cards and rear transition modules and supports OpenVPX backplanes with switch fabric support for up to 6.25Gbaud. The chassis has dimensions of 18.96x15.69x19.53inches and meets ANSI and VITA 65 power and cooling requirements. The chassis' card cage is constructed of conduction-cooled extruded and machined aluminum.


The chassis maintains card cage rails at 55°C or below and is designed for the latest REDI, VPX, and OpenVPX specifications. It incorporates a fan speed control feature that decreases acoustic noise at low temperature. The company also provides custom integration and configurations for the chassis.
